Output 26d96c5d555915c0524d1ac26f649e37578d4ca42c810c5505f96813522c7a05:0

value
709274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d974c892772bfc3974615091d95dcf32b1108636 OP_EQUAL
address
3MWpTRstZQhPoEQ6VuEDmgZ1xZ7J3VzfVz
transaction
26d96c5d555915c0524d1ac26f649e37578d4ca42c810c5505f96813522c7a05
spent
true